This hiking vacation is perfect for beginners and adventurous families with kids (+10 years) who want to explore the National Park's majestic mountains, tranquil lakes, and breathtaking vistas. With a kid-friendly and flexible itinerary, you'll stay in the same cozy, full-board cabin each day, so you can enjoy the beauty of the area without the hassle of moving from place to place.
Over the course of 5 days in Jotunheimen, you'll explore some of the most scenic areas, from easy lake walks and ferry rides to more challenging circuits. After each day of hiking, you'll return to your cabin, where you'll be treated to traditional Norwegian meals and warm hospitality. These cabins are the perfect place to relax, unwind and share stories of your adventure with your family.
Your adventure begins and ends in Oslo, with comfortable accommodation before and after your time in Jotunheimen. This gives you the opportunity to explore the city and enjoy its cultural offerings, giving you the perfect balance of nature and city vacation.

During your Jotunheimen Trek, you will spend your nights in mountain huts. In the mountain huts we normally only book dormitories, but we can look into private rooms on request. If the private rooms are fully booked or not available in the hut, we automatically book a bed in dormitories for you. Please note that private rooms are more expensive and there will be an additional charge for this.
Accommodation at the huts includes breakfast, lunch, and dinner. We will arrange this for you as well. This allows you to travel lighter and have one less thing to worry about.
Accommodation before and after the trek is included. If possible, we also organize breakfast.
You have to make your own way to the starting point. The total amount does not include personal transport.
Should you need any form of (public) transport on location, this is not part of the trekking package. This includes the use of taxi, bus, cable cars, gondolas, ferries, etc.
Your international travel insurance is your own responsibility. Discuss your itinerary with the insurance company before your trek.
Personal expenses on such as souvenirs, drinks, and other similar expenses are for your own account.
